Free online and in-person tutoring services available
The UA-PTC Learning Assistance Center (LAC) provides students the support and services needed to achieve their educational goals at UA - Pulaski Tech.
The LAC offers free tutoring assistance for currently enrolled students online and in-person when the college is open at the Main Campus and at the Little Rock-South site.
Both professional and peer tutors offer assistance in a wide variety of difference subjects and disciplines, including Mathematics, Chemistry and Physics, Accounting, English and Reading, Spanish, and more.
